US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"streamline assistance"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when referring to making help or support processes more efficient and effective. Example: "Our goal is to streamline assistance for our customers by reducing response times and improving service quality."

FAQs

How can I rephrase "streamline assistance" to sound more formal?

For a more formal tone, consider alternatives such as "optimize support", "enhance support mechanisms", or "improve assistance delivery". These options add a level of sophistication appropriate for professional or academic contexts.

What does it mean to "streamline" something?

To streamline something means to make it more efficient and effective by simplifying processes or removing unnecessary steps. In the context of assistance, it means making the process of providing help or support quicker and easier.

Is "streamline assistance" appropriate for all types of writing?

While "streamline assistance" is generally correct, it is best suited for formal and business contexts. In more casual settings, consider using simpler alternatives like "simplify support" or "make aid more efficient".

How do I know if I should use "streamline assistance" over another phrase?

Use "streamline assistance" when you specifically want to emphasize the efficiency gains achieved through simplifying processes and removing bottlenecks in providing help or support. If you're focused solely on speed, "expedite aid" might be a better choice.
